public class TestLazyPersistReplicaRecovery extends LazyPersistTestCase {
@Test
public void testDnRestartWithSavedReplicas()
throws IOException, InterruptedException, TimeoutException {
getClusterBuilder().build();
FSNamesystem fsn = cluster.getNamesystem();
final DataNode dn = cluster.getDataNodes().get(0);
DatanodeDescriptor dnd =
NameNodeAdapter.getDatanode(fsn, dn.getDatanodeId());
final String METHOD_NAME = GenericTestUtils.getMethodName();
Path path1 = new Path("/" + METHOD_NAME + ".01.dat");
makeTestFile(path1, BLOCK_SIZE, true);
ensureFileReplicasOnStorageType(path1, RAM_DISK);
// Sleep for a short time to allow the lazy writer thread to do its job.
// However the block replica should not be evicted from RAM_DISK yet.
FsDatasetImpl fsDImpl = (FsDatasetImpl) DataNodeTestUtils.getFSDataset(dn);
GenericTestUtils
.waitFor(() -> fsDImpl.getNonPersistentReplicas() == 0, 10,
3 * LAZY_WRITER_INTERVAL_SEC * 1000);
ensureFileReplicasOnStorageType(path1, RAM_DISK);
LOG.info("Restarting the DataNode");
assertTrue("DN did not restart properly",
cluster.restartDataNode(0, true));
// wait for blockreport
waitForBlockReport(dn, dnd);
// Ensure that the replica is now on persistent storage.
ensureFileReplicasOnStorageType(path1, DEFAULT);
}
@Test
public void testDnRestartWithUnsavedReplicas()
throws IOException, InterruptedException, TimeoutException {
getClusterBuilder().build();
FsDatasetTestUtil.stopLazyWriter(cluster.getDataNodes().get(0));
final String METHOD_NAME = GenericTestUtils.getMethodName();
Path path1 = new Path("/" + METHOD_NAME + ".01.dat");
makeTestFile(path1, BLOCK_SIZE, true);
ensureFileReplicasOnStorageType(path1, RAM_DISK);
LOG.info("Restarting the DataNode");
cluster.restartDataNode(0, true);
cluster.waitActive();
// Ensure that the replica is still on transient storage.
ensureFileReplicasOnStorageType(path1, RAM_DISK);
}
private boolean waitForBlockReport(final DataNode dn,
final DatanodeDescriptor dnd) throws IOException, InterruptedException {
final DatanodeStorageInfo storage = dnd.getStorageInfos()[0];
final long lastCount = storage.getBlockReportCount();
dn.triggerBlockReport(
new BlockReportOptions.Factory().setIncremental(false).build());
try {
GenericTestUtils
.waitFor(() -> lastCount != storage.getBlockReportCount(), 10, 10000);
} catch (TimeoutException te) {
LOG.error("Timeout waiting for block report for {}", dnd);
return false;
}
return true;
}
}
